Results: Bonhams Sept. 20 Bonmont Auction
London, ENGLAND -- Although it was a 2012 Bugatti Veyron 16.4 Super Sport Coupe that took top sale honors at Bonhams’ first traditional live auction since February, 20th century classics also did well in the Sept. 20 sale at the Bonmont Golf & Country Club in Cheserex, Switzerland.

This 1964 Maserati Mistral Spyder sold for CHF 431,250 (US$ 466,199) inc. premium. Photo: Bonhams
The Bugatti sold for 1,840,000 Swiss Francs while a 1964 Maserati Mistral Spyder -- one of only 125 convertibles produced of one of the marque's most desirable models -- sold for 431,250 Swiss Francs after being in the same family’s ownership since 1971.
